
From the SarcasticGamer.com article: "Welcome to the sixth in a series of guides for the different starting classes in Mass Effect 2! If you enjoy this guide, please check out our other Survival Guides.
So, you want to be a soldier? Well, the good news is that despite some limitations you are probably picking the easiest class to understand and play with in Mass Effect 2. Unlike the first game where it was not advisable to play as a soldier on your first play through, picking the soldier class in Mass Effect 2 will have you running and gunning around the galaxy like an intergalactic badass in no time at all."
